Family Minister Karin Prien is planning comprehensive changes to early childhood education in Germany with a new childcare law that is set to take effect in 2027. Under this law, every child will be assessed for their language and developmental status by the age of four at the latest, and support will be provided as needed, while the federal government intends to allocate a total of 9.25 billion euros to improve childcare facilities in challenging situations.
